Frequently Asked Questions

  1. Can I read this eBook on a non‑Kindle device? Yes – the Kindle app is available for iOS, Android, Windows, and macOS.
  2. Is the content updated after purchase? Elsevier pushes annual cloud updates; your library will refresh automatically.
  3. How does the search function work? It indexes the full 1,733‑page text, returning results in under 0.3 seconds on typical Wi‑Fi.
  4. What accessibility features are included? Full screen‑reader support, adjustable font sizes, high‑contrast mode, and WCAG 2.2 AA compliance.
  5. Can I export chapters as PDFs? Not directly; you can use Kindle’s “Print‑to‑PDF” workaround, but DRM remains.
  6. Is there a trial period? Amazon offers a 7‑day free preview of the first 5 % of the book.
  7. How many devices can I use simultaneously? Up to four devices can be registered to your Amazon account.
  8. Does it work offline? Yes – once downloaded, the entire book is available without internet.
